How Fighting for Justice in Orleans: The Public Defenders' Tireless Effort Actually Works

At its core, Fighting for Justice in Orleans: The Public Defenders' Tireless Effort refers to the dedicated professionals who provide legal representation to eligible individuals charged with crimes but unable to afford private attorneys. These attorneys are employed by the public defender's office and are tasked with navigating the complexities of the law on behalf of their clients, from arraignment through potential trial or plea resolution. Their role involves thorough investigation, case strategy development, and vigorous advocacy within the boundaries of the law to ensure due process is respected.

For a hypothetical resident facing a charge, the process typically begins with an eligibility assessment during an initial court appearance, where income and case circumstances are reviewed. If qualified, the assigned public defender reviews police reports, interviews witnesses, and examines evidence to build a defense tailored to the specific allegations. This might involve negotiating with prosecutors to reduce charges or securing alternative sentencing options that address underlying issues rather than solely imposing penalties. The effort is grounded in the routine application of legal procedures designed to protect rights while promoting fair outcomes within the established judicial framework.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A common misconception is that public defenders are less capable or committed than private attorneys, stemming in part from the assumption that financial investment correlates directly with quality. In reality, public defenders undergo the same rigorous licensing and ethical standards as their private counterparts and frequently develop deep expertise in negotiation and criminal procedure due to the volume and complexity of their work. The narrative that public defense is inherently inferior overlooks the skill required to manage demanding dockets while advocating effectively within the system.

Another misunderstanding involves the scope of support provided. Some individuals may believe that representation is limited to court appearances, but Fighting for Justice in Orleans: The Public Defenders' Tireless Effort encompasses pre-charge consultations, investigations, plea bargain discussions, and post-conviction proceedings. Public defenders work to identify all relevant factors, including mental health, substance abuse, or socio-economic circumstances, that might inform a more just outcome. Clarifying these points helps the public appreciate the comprehensive nature of public defense services and dispels myths rooted in incomplete information.
